Total Texture Series : The Science & Identification of all hair textures
E-Learning
TOTAL TEXTURE E-LEARNING with Charlotte Mensah
The science and identification of all hair textures
Closed Captions Available Throughout
Level: Foundation
Investment: FREE
Who is the ideal student?
Course Description:
Total Texture is an online introductory course that explains the science behind why hair texture varies and how it influences different hairdressing skill sets. Led by Charlotte Mensah, Total Texture will give you the foundation knowledge to understand all textures, whether coily, curly, wavy or straight.
“If you want to be a great hairdresser it is so important to know how to work with every hair type so that anyone who walks through your door can be welcomed. Even if it is a basic service you are able to do it with confidence.” – Charlotte Mensah
Every client has a unique fingerprint of shape, diameter, density and porosity; this course will help unlock the understanding of how these elements intertwine. Then at the end of the module an expert panel discusses how texture influences skill sets. This covers care with Nicole Iroh (Headmasters Artistic Ambassador), styling with Claire Martin (Master Stylist Gro London), cutting with Dexter Dapper Johnson (Toni & Guy International Artistic Director), colouring with Paul Dennison (Technical Director Ken Picton Salon), wigs and weaves with Lisa Farrall (Found Wig London) and perm and relaxers with Charlotte herself.
Total Texture is the perfect starting place for all newcomers to the industry, stylists looking to expand their skill set or pre-training before coming to learn with us hands-on at one of the L'Oréal Academies across the United Kingdom and Ireland.

Total Texture Series 2: Embracing the Natural with Claire Martin
Video
EMBRACING THE NATURAL
Build your confidence with Claire Martin, from Gro London, as shares her top tips and go to techniques when ‘embracing the natural’. Claire explains the various steps that should be followed when working with porous hair textures and demonstrates the LOC method and the wash & go technique.
